Default New Vinson 500

I just bought a manual vinson a couple of months ago and was wondering if there were any suggestions on any upgrades I should do. I've been reading the posts and it seems that most have upgraded the air filter, what is the best brand to go with?

I also was wondering if it is normal to hear the valves tapping when your in too high of a gear at low rpm (sometimes have trouble shifting due to large snow boots and snow build up around the shifter).

Default New Vinson 500

Jet kit is a must. If you do any mods you will have to rejet. If noise aint a problem a pipe and jet kit really helps alot.

How much $$$ do you want to spend? What are you expecting to gain?
I think most bikes valves rattle for a while til they get broken in, then they will quiet down a little. If it bothers you the dealer will check them on the first service. Go with the Amsoil synthetic oil also. The air filter by itself is not going to help you, power wise.

If you want more power,

K&N air filter- $50.00
Diamond G racing snorkel-$50.00
Dynojet kit - $50.00
HMF exhaust- $200.00
Webcam- $128.00
EPI clutch kit (manual)- $50.00
All of these mods you can do yourself with a few hand tools and a little time and patience.
